A Deep Dive Into “exchequer

Meaning

  • [Noun]
  • An office of revenue taxation; a treasury.
  • An available fund of money, especially one for a specific purpose.
  • [Verb]
  • (transitive) To proceed against (a person) in the Court of Exchequer.
